Begemder

Begemder was a province in the north-eastern part of Ethiopia, with its capital city at Gondar.

The earliest recorded mention of Begemder was on the map of Fra Mauro, (c.1460), where it is described as a kingdom. Emperor Lebna Dengel , in his letter to the King of Portugal (1526), also described Begemder as a kingdom but one that was part of his empire. With the adoption of the constitution in 1995, Begemder was divided between the Benishangul-Gumaz, the Tigray, and the Amhara Regions of Ethiopia.
